Across TCGA cell cohorts, GPR68 mutation is significantly associated with the RNA expression of many other genes, with 12 significant associations in total. LARGE_INTESTINE shows the largest number of these associations.

The most reproducible GPR68-associated genes across cancer lineages are RBMY1A1, IFNA8, and ACER1. Each is linked with GPR68 in more than 1 cancer types. Because this analysis shows association rather than direction, both GPR68-to-partner and partner-to-GPR68 results are reported.
